Important Safety Tips for Talking to Strangers Online
Meeting new people can be enjoyable, but strangers are still strangers.
A friendly conversation does not prove that another person is honest.
Follow these basic rules on every platform.
1. Do Not Share Your Address
Never provide your exact home address, office address, school, hostel, or regular daily route.
Even when someone appears trustworthy, keep your physical location private.
2. Never Share Passwords or OTPs
No genuine stranger needs your:
- Password.
- One-time password.
- Banking PIN.
- Card number.
- UPI PIN.
- Account-recovery code.
Anyone asking for this information may be attempting fraud.
3. Do Not Send Money
Be careful when a person tells an emotional story and then asks for money.
Online scammers may create fake emergencies involving:
- Medical treatment.
- Travel.
- Lost wallets.
- Family problems.
- Phone recharge.
- Investments.
- Gifts or delivery charges.
You are never required to pay someone because you chatted with them.
4. Protect Your Photos
Do not send private or intimate pictures.
The other person may:
- Save them.
- Record the screen.
- Forward them.
- Post them publicly.
- Use them to threaten or blackmail you.
Once a private image leaves your device, you may not be able to control it.
5. Check Your Video Background
Before enabling your camera, look behind you.
Remove or hide:
- Identity cards.
- Letters containing your address.
- School or office logos.
- Family photographs.
- Vehicle numbers.
- Windows showing your location.
- Private documents.
A small visible detail may reveal more than you expect.
6. Do Not Open Suspicious Links
A stranger may send a link claiming it contains a photo, gift, profile, video, or verification page.
The link could lead to:
- A fake login page.
- Malware.
- A tracking website.
- A payment scam.
- An adult or illegal page.
Open only links you understand and trust.
7. Leave Uncomfortable Conversations
You are free to leave at any time.
End the conversation when someone:
- Insults you.
- Threatens you.
- Pressures you.
- Requests private content.
- Makes repeated sexual comments.
- Asks for money.
- Tries to control you.
- Refuses to respect your boundaries.
You do not need to argue or explain.
8. Use Block and Report Tools
Blocking prevents further contact where the platform supports it.
Reporting also helps moderators identify users who may be harming others.
Use these tools when appropriate.
9. Be Careful About Offline Meetings
Meeting an online stranger in person creates extra risk.
When deciding to meet:
- Tell a trusted person.
- Select a busy public location.
- Arrange your own transport.
- Do not visit a private home.
- Keep your phone charged.
- Share your live location with someone you trust.
- Leave immediately when something feels wrong.
Minors should not arrange offline meetings with unknown adults.
10. Respect Other Users
Safety is not only about protecting yourself. It is also about behaving responsibly.
Do not:
- Harass people.
- Record without permission.
- Share another person’s private information.
- Pressure users to turn on their camera.
- Make threats.
- Send unwanted sexual content.
- Pretend to be someone else for harmful purposes.
A good stranger-chat community depends on mutual respect.

Easy Ways to Start a Conversation With a Stranger
Beginning with only “hi” may not always lead to an interesting reply.
Try a simple question that gives the other person something to discuss.
Friendly Opening Questions
- How has your day been?
- Which city are you chatting from?
- What kind of music do you enjoy?
- Have you watched any good movie recently?
- What do you usually do in your free time?
- Are you a tea person or a coffee person?
- What is one place you want to visit?
- What made you join the chat today?
- Which language do you prefer?
- What is something interesting about your city?
Fun Questions
- Which superpower would you choose?
- What food could you eat every week?
- Would you prefer mountains or beaches?
- What is the funniest thing that happened to you recently?
- Which movie can you watch many times?
- Would you travel to the past or the future?
- What would your perfect free day look like?
- Which song is currently stuck in your head?
Questions to Avoid at the Beginning
Do not immediately ask for:
- Full name.
- Exact address.
- Phone number.
- Income.
- Private photographs.
- Relationship details.
- Social-media password.
- Personal documents.
Allow the conversation to become comfortable naturally.
